Niger Delta Advancement Awards (NDAA) has officially released the list of nominees for the 2011 edition. In the press conference held on Thursday 21st July 2011 at Beverly Hills Hotel, Port Harcourt, the NDAA President, Oxford T. Okpalefe officially released the list of nominees and ordered the immediate commencement of voting via SMS.
He urged everyone present and the public to always vote for the nominees of their choice by typing ‘NDAA (Space) V-code’ and send to 33120 on all networks. According to the NDAA President, the 5th Niger Delta Advancement Awards (NDAA) 2011 is scheduled to hold in Uyo, Akwa Ibom state in September; date to be disclosed in due course. The NDAA President, Mr. Oxford T. Okpalefe further explained that the music category has been expanded to accommodate all genres of music which will further promote Niger Delta music artistes nationally and internationally. Niger Delta Advancement Awards (NDAA) organised annually by Bunox Communications Ltd., Publishers of JUVENIS magazine started in the year 2007 and now holding its 5th edition.
The mission is to create a platform that will encourage indigenous enterprise and individual efforts for a positive transformation in the Niger Delta. Below is the nominees list for the 5th Niger Delta Advancement Awards (NDAA) 2011. For more details, visit: www.ndaa.bunoxcom.com
